JOB CHANGES

West Valley Medical Center has welcomed Dr. Hillary Elins, who joined the OB/GYN Associates medical staff and began seeing patients this month.

Elins practiced for two years at the Wright-Patterson Air Force Base/Wright State School of Medicine, then in Idaho for the past year at Mountain Home Air Force Base Medical Center. Last year she was awarded the U.S. Air Force Commendation Medal, given for meritorious service.

Elins earned her bachelor's degree in molecular and cellular biology from the University of Arizona before moving on to receive her medical degree from American University of the Caribbean, Netherland Antilles, with clinical rotations at Johns Hopkins and University of Illinois. She completed her residency at Methodist Health System. Elins is board-certified in obstetrics and gynecology. She has particular interest in minimally invasive GYN surgery, menopause and general obstetrics care.

Larry Miller Subaru welcomes Lynn Killian to its team. She transfered from Larry Miller Honda. Killian has been with the automotive group for 19 years as a sales and leasing consultant. She has also been a real estate agent for eight years.

RECOGNITION

J. Stephen Herring, leader for the U.S. Department of Energy's Idaho National Laboratory research on nuclear hydrogen production, has been named a Fellow by the American Nuclear Society. The Fellow designation is the highest honor ANS can bestow on an individual and acknowledges outstanding leadership, professional accomplishment and service to the profession.

A native of Cedar Rapids, Iowa, Herring completed his undergraduate education at Iowa State University. He earned a doctorate in nuclear engineering from Massachusetts Institute of Technology. Since coming to INL in 1979, he has achieved a continued stream of recognition, and most recently was appointed a Laboratory Fellow.

Idaho Sleep Specialists P.C. in Boise received program accreditation from the American Academy of Sleep Medicine.

To receive a five-year accreditation, a sleep center must meet or exceed all standards for professional health care designated by the academy. The accreditation process involves detailed inspection of a center's facility and staff, including an evaluation of testing procedures, patient contacts, and physician training. Additionally, the facility's goals must be clearly stated and include plans for positively affecting the quality of medical care in the community it serves.

Idaho Sleep Specialists P.C. is directed by Dr. Brett Troyer and is located at 403 S. 11th St. For more information, call 895-0411.

GOOD DEEDS

A grant from the OfficeMax Boise Community Fund helped sponsor Diabetes Prevention and Safety Programs in 20 local schools over the past year. Humphreys Diabetes Center trained teachers and staff on how to prevent emergencies and care for children with type 1 diabetes in their schools. The programs also taught students how to stay active and eat healthy to prevent childhood obesity and type 2 diabetes.
